Transaction 10207786fc2ee5c9e0b856067b16f12ef544d95efc3cbcc7a3e85811d244cb59
1 Input
1 Output
-
10207786fc2ee5c9e0b856067b16f12ef544d95efc3cbcc7a3e85811d244cb59:0
- value
- 3715062
- script pubkey
- OP_0 OP_PUSHBYTES_20 aa8b29c34a172e7e5fd4f218471c175c13f2ddcf
- address
- bc1q429jns62zuh8uh757gvyw8qhtsfl9hw0ae0syh